They installed my Borla and did a good job and I've seen a set of his duals on an f-body. It looked good to me.
Ya, he has pressure bent pipes, but I'm not into the extra cost of mandrel for the measley HP difference since mine will not go over the axle so there won't be any harsh bends.
I've seen some duals done by Lewisville Muffler and they looked good too.
